The Insurance Council of New Zealand – Te Kāhui Inihua o Aotearoa (ICNZ) and the Australian and New Zealand Institute of Insurance and Finance (ANZIIF) have announced the opening of the ICNZ Scholarship, with submissions now being accepted.

The ICNZ and ANZIIF Scholarship is an annual program designed to acknowledge exceptional insurance professionals who display the potential to become future industry leaders.

The recipient of this scholarship, provided by ICNZ, will receive NZ$10,000 to participate in an international conference or seminar program. This opportunity offers valuable development prospects within the insurance sector and fosters leadership skills.

Tim Grafton, chief executive of ICNZ, emphasized the commitment of ICNZ and ANZIIF to investing in individuals and nurturing the next generation of industry leaders.

“This scholarship has opened many doors of opportunity for previous winners, significantly contributing to their professional development, leadership skills and industry networks. I encourage all eligible individuals to apply,” ANZIIF CEO Prue Willsford said.

Entrants looking to try out for the scholarship are required to submit a 2,500-word essay addressing the following topic:

  • The capability of generative Artificial Intelligence (AI) applications like ChatGPT to create text, auditory and visual content given prompts and existing data suggests potential applications to many sectors including for general insurance and its value chain. Discuss the benefits and risks for insurers of using this technology to recommend whether to adopt it, and, if so, how, or if not, why not?

The application deadline is Nov. 6. Further details can be found on the scholarship webpage.
